On June 27, 2026, two Palestinians succumbed to injuries sustained during recent violations of the ceasefire in Gaza. These fatalities are the latest in a series of escalating incidents that have raised alarms both locally and internationally regarding the stability of the region. The names of the deceased have not been released, but their deaths are emblematic of the ongoing conflict that has persisted despite previous attempts at peace.
The situation in Gaza remains precarious, with various factions involved in the ongoing hostilities. The recent violations of the ceasefire have been attributed to a breakdown in negotiations between Israeli and Palestinian authorities. This breakdown is particularly concerning as it occurs against a backdrop of heightened tensions following the recent elections in Israel, where right-wing parties have gained significant traction, further complicating the prospect for peace.
